User-Friendly Controls
The operator comfort starts with the large cab that offers tilt steering. Operators will easily be able to become comfortable with the multi-function joystick precise positioning technology. This feature offers easy maneuverability in a fast manner with little effort from the operator.
Multi-Function at Multiple Sites
The 4-wheel drive and infinitely variable hydrostatic transmission enable Genie telehandlers to operate on practically any worksite. There are 3 steering modes, such as coordinated, front wheel and crab steer that provide a tight turning radius and increased maneuverability.
Better Efficiency
The auxiliary hydraulics can be simply tailored by the operators to be able to meet the correct requirements of the particular attachment being chosen. The Genie GTH-5519 telehandler is equipped with a standard auxiliary hydraulic system. This provides complete reversible flow and proportional or continuous flow to the boom tip.
Made For Serviceability
Terex machines are designed for serviceability. They provide interchangeable components which are common, along with easy to access, no-tool access to daily inspection points in order to make Genie telehandlers as straightforward to service as they are to use.
Compact Maneuverability
Genie telehandlers are lightweight and compact, making them easy to bring to the jobsite and easy to maneuver once they are there. The Genie GTH-5519 is made to boost mobility and gets the task done in tight areas. These telehandlers have the lift capacity to raise as much as 5000 pounds or 2500 kilograms.
